Find the periods of two physical pendulums consisting of identical thin rigid rods of length L = 138 cm. The first rod is pivoted about it's upper end, while the second rod is pivoted at a small hole drilled through the rod at a distance d = 103 cm from it's lower end, see the picture below. Note that the mass of the rod is not important — it cancels out. If it helps, take m = 1 kg.
